Building Physical Literacy for an Active Generation
This panel discussion explores how Physical Literacy can be developed to support an active generation through the integration of policy, science, education, and practical application. The session brings together experts from government, academia, and the sports sector to share insights and approaches in promoting physical activity among children and youth in Thailand.

How to Train Your Senior Clients
As aging populations increase across Asia, senior fitness has become one of the fastest-growing segments within the wellness industry. This session addresses key principles for training older adults safely and effectively. The focus is on assessment, appropriate exercise selection, and adaptive program design that supports daily function, independence, and long-term quality of life.

Longevity and Functional Aging: The Future of Fitness Business
This session explores how the concept of Longevity is becoming a new growth driver for the fitness business. Drawing on ISSA’s Functional Aging framework, the session will present a shift in business perspective—from traditional strength training to movement-based, assessment-driven approaches that help extend quality of life and unlock new opportunities in the aging society market.
